How to grow kumquat in spring

1. Appropriate lighting

In spring it needs the help of plenty of light to grow well. If it stays in a very shady environment for a long time, the branches and leaves will grow too long, affecting flowering and fruiting. Generally speaking, the sunlight in spring is not too strong, so try to get as much sunlight as possible.

2. Proper pruning

Spring is a good season for pruning, and it is best to prune before the plants sprout. Only keep the older, stronger, and more evenly-proportioned branches, and cut off other unsuitable ones, such as diseased, insect-infested, dry, dense, and overgrown branches. And the buds on the branches also need to be dealt with, leaving two or three buds on each branch.

3. Appropriate amount of fertilizer

Spring is a period of vigorous growth, so use fertilizer appropriately. Generally, fertilizer can be applied once a week to ten days, and the water used can be decomposed thin sauce residue.

4. Appropriate amount of water

Its growth cannot be separated from water, but it is afraid of waterlogging, so while it should be watered in time, it should not be too wet. If it is too dry, spray some water.

5. Repotting

You can change the pot in spring and mix new soil with leaf mold, sandy soil and cake fertilizer in a ratio of 4:5:1, which has a good effect. The roots can be trimmed while repotting.
